One to watch: Francis Lung

Francis Lung’s (aka Tom McClung, ex member of WU LYF) debut single, “A Selfish Man” is one of my favourite tracks right now. Partly because it’s kicks off with what sounds like some good old fashioned finger clicking, partly because it makes me think of summer strolling, but mainly because it’s just so jazzy and so laid back at the same time. It’s the sort of song you just close your eyes and sway to. I’m doing it right now as I write this post…

francis lung 1source

Francis’s tumblr tells us “the album is currently being recorded. it’s currently doing ma head in. it should be done in about 3 days, it probably won’t be. STAY TUNED! DON’T TELL YOUR PARENTS!”

I’m excited.

The Spanish Banger

I first heard Bailando by Daniel Steinberg, rather appropriately, in Menorca in the Summer. Last night, during a very odd evening which involved wearing blankets as turbans, it came on again and I remembered just how great it was. So I did a bit of browsing and found out, disappointingly, that Daniel isn’t Spanish. He’s German. A German DJ, I believe. No matter, this is still the ultimate spanish banger. It starts with the dripping of a tap (ooooh the suspense), before turning into a seriously jazzy, infectious tune. It sort of reminds me of Kwabena by Tuesday Born, but this is like Kwabena’s more hyperactive sister.
